Overview:
A full-time Research Specialist I/II position is available in the laboratory of Dr. John Jimah at Princeton University. We study the mechanisms of membrane remodeling processes in human cells and malaria parasites. We primarily apply cryo-electron microscopy and tomography to investigate how human and parasite proteins enable cellular processes including endocytosis and the biogenesis of organelles. Responsibilities:
The main responsibilities of the research specialist will be the expression and purification of proteins from bacterial, insect, and mammalian expression systems. There is also the opportunity for independent structural studies using cryoEM and/or X-ray crystallography. The research specialist will also have the opportunity to develop their own independent research project.

Attention to detail, precision, good record keeping, organization, time-management and communication skills are essential.
The research specialist will have the opportunity to learn a variety of molecular biology, biochemical/biophysical, and structural biology techniques in a collaborative, vibrant, and supportive environment.
  • Protein expression in bacterial, insect, and mammalian expression systems.
  • Protein purification by affinity and size exclusion chromatography.
  • Maintenance of standard mammalian and insect cell lines for protein expression (for example, HEK 293 F cells).
  • Molecular biology procedures including recombinant DNA technology, cloning protein constructs, polymerase chain reaction, sequencing of DNA, plasmid isolation.
  • Performing well-established biochemical and biophysical assays, including calorimetric enzymatic assays.
